You can not decide who you fall in love with, do you?

 

Yes, the book is about a brother and sister who engage in an incestuous relationship but it is much much more than that. The life of Lochan and Maya is extremely difficult, at their young age they have responsibilities they should not have and the only support they have is each other.

 

"He was always so much more than just a brother. He was my soulmate, my fresh air, the reason I look forward to getting up in the morning. He is my brother, he is my best friend"

 

"The human body needs a constant flow of nourishment, air and love to survive. Without Maya I lose al three; apart we wil slowly die"

 

Forbidden was a pure, beautiful and heart aching journey and anyone who is a little intrigued with taboos or simply enjoy romance and emotional reads should go for it. It's soo worth it! The author did a great job in allowing me to connect with each of the characters, I cared and felt for them except the mother, who was a selfish, thoughtless bitch.
